Description
nuxt-api-party
allows developers to proxy requests to an API without exposing credentials to the client. A previous vulnerability allowed an attacker to change the baseURL of the request, potentially leading to credentials being leaked or SSRF.
Recommendation
Update the nuxt-api-party
package to the latest compatible version. Followings are version details:
- Affected version(s): < 0.22.0
- Patched version(s): 0.22.0
